An exciting opportunity has arisen for an experienced candidate to join The Regional Development Programme at Norwich City Football Club in the role of Player Development Centre Coach for our Cambridgeshire region, this is for 1.5 hours per week on Monday evenings in either Linton & Northstowe. This is an excellent role for someone who possess the following qualifications and experiences.

  • Level 1 Coaching qualification with a UEFA C License/ FA Level 2 or higher in a football or above desirable
  • Experience of coaching young players
  • Emergency First Aid Certificate
  • Safeguarding Children Certificate

Key tasks/responsibilities include, but are not limited to:

  • Planning and delivering training sessions in line with the RDP’s training philosophy.
  • Ensuring our players have fantastic experiences and fall in love with football.
  • Write end of season player progress reports
  • To act in a manner that supports the Club’s Values of Growth, Integrity, Belonging, Resilience, Pride and Commitment

All staff who work for the RDP will receive the following benefits

  • Staff CPD and personal development opportunities
  • Progression opportunities into full-time permanent work
  • Extra paid work during school holidays (Subject to availability)
